(PTI) The Supreme Court today reserved its verdict on a batch of petitions challenging constitutional validity of the practice of triple talaq among Muslims. A five-judge Constitution bench headed by Chief Justice J S Khehar heard the issue for six days during which various parties including the Centre, All India Muslim Personal Law Board, All India Muslim Women Personal Law Board and various others made the submissions. The bench, also comprising Justices Kurian Joseph, R F Nariman, U U Lalit and Abdul Nazeer, had begun the hearing on May 11. (PTI) Consumers would soon be able to buy energy efficient LED bulbs, tubelights and ceiling fans at petrol pumps at much lower retail rates. The consumer would get the LED bulb for Rs 65, tubelight for Rs 230 and ceiling fan at Rs 1,150.These appliances would be sourced by the three state-run oil marketing companies (OMCs) — Hindustan Petroleum, Indian Oil and Bharat Petroleum — from the state-run Energy Efficiency Services Ltd (EESL). (NDTV) Environment Minister Anil Dave has died at 60. Prime Minister Narendra Modi tweeted that he was “absolutely shocked” and described Mr Dave’s death as a “personal loss”. He wrote, “I was with Anil Madhav Dave ji till late last evening, discussing key policy issues.” The prime minister also said Mr Dave would be remembered as a devoted public servant and was tremendously passionate towards conserving the environment.Mr Dave, who had a longtime association with the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S), was appointed Environment Minister last year. (FE) The ministry of civil aviation is trying to make certain changes in the regional connectivity scheme — before the second round of bidding — to make it more investor- and business-friendly. Sources said the proposed changes deal with exclusive rights to fly on the commercially lucrative routes, added benefits for airlines operating on the routes in smaller towns and backward regions, and acquisition of aircraft by the regional airlines.
